Mom Thinks 13-Yr-Old Son Is Mowing Lawn—When She Finds Out Where He Secretly Snuck Off to, She’s “Bawling Her Eyes Out”

In a great many ways motherhood can feel like a thankless job, especially in your child’s younger years. And for the most part, parents are okay with that phase for the joy set before them and the anticipation of the beautiful young men and women they are raising.

You spend days, months, and years pouring your heart and soul into your kids, just praying that what you’re doing to instill values, work ethic, and character into them pays off.

But for Krystal June Preston, that “payoff” came in a way that she NEVER would have expected from her 13-year-old son William.

William’s unanticipated grand gesture came at a time when Krystal was down and out — and it is absolutely heart-melting. Krystal posted her story to Facebook, and William’s act of kindness for his mama quickly went viral. Find out just what this selfless teen did below:

“I have no words right now that can express how I am feeling at this moment. I’m in complete shock. The last couple weeks have literally been hell filled with so many tears, anger, confusion and heartache. Today I got the shock of my life.

As some of you may know my son William, who is a lawn mowing, yard cleaning, money making machine. Well my son had a job today that he had to go do and so I allowed him to go assuming it was like any other time. Well this time was different. Very different.

William came home and said

‘Mom I bought you a car.’
